Call of Duty Zombies goes Black Ops on iOS

Want more zombies on you Apple device of choice? Call of Duty has the answer, with another entry in the franchises iOS ‘zombie experience’, this time riffing on Call of Duty Black Ops.

The Call of Duty: Black Ops Zombies app has been built specifically for Apple devices, and although optimised to perform best on 3rd generation and higher models, promises to be equally impressive on it’s gory goodness no matter what size screen your playing on – whether it’s iPad or iPhone.

There are 50 levels of the fan favourite zombie mode on offer here, and to keep that famous Call of Duty team spirit alive there’s even voice chat available in the multiplayer. Up to four players can join a game to take down the undead hordes, and fans should keep an eye out for future updates that will include feature upgrades and extra maps (surprise!).

Ready to build some more barricades?

Black Ops Zombies is available now on the App Store, priced at $7.49

Madman Announces New Acquisitions

Madman Entertainment have been running a Facebook campaign throughout last month, giving hints for a supposed huge suprise announcement of acquired titles. Well, the announcement has been made. Madman shocked the country by announcing the acquisitions, which featured titles that no one could have predicted.

The newly licensed titles are as follows:

  • Coicent/Five Numbers – Two OVAs to be released in a combo pack April 2012.
  • Maken Ki –  No release information has been made available.
  • Madoka Magica – To be released in April 2012.
  • Future Diary – Streamed in Madman Screening Room and then eventually a DVD release.
  • Heaven’s Lost Property (Season 1 and 2) – Season 1 to be released on DVD and Blu-Ray in March 2012. The second season will be released at a later date which is yet to be confirmed.
  • Persona 4 – Streamed in Madman Screening Room and then eventually a DVD release.

Assassins on the iPad with Assassin’s Creed Recollection

You’ve got to watch out for Ubisoft’s Assassins these days – they get everywhere! The latest victim of the developers premier franchise? The iPad. The world of Assassin’s Creed has been transformed into an in depth tactical board game for the tablet, and is now available in the App store for $2.99.

A tactical board game? How on earth does that work? Well first, check out the trailer at the end of the page – now, understood? If you’re like me then perhaps you’re still none the wiser, so read on.

The game offers a narrative experience up to ten hours long, taking in the entire world of Assassin’s Creed. 20 story missions take players on a journey from Barcelona to Constantinople, and the game can also be taken online to challenge other players from around the world in real time battles. It’s all about having a master strategic plan, and presumably playing your cards right (sorry).

This was something of a surprise release from Ubisoft, so there’s not much information about how the gameplay actually works, but perhaps that’s all part of the mysterious master assassin plan…

If you fancy finding out for yourself then you’re in for an extra treat – the animated short film Assassin’s Creed Embers is included free with the download. The short was also included in some of the numerous special editions of Assassin’s Creed Revelations, so this is yet another chance for fans to catch up on the final chapter of the adventures of Ezio Auditore.

The Adventures of Tintin: Secret of the Unicorn – The Game is out now

The first installment in a planned trilogy of Tintin movies is finally heading to Australian cinemas on the day after Christmas. The Steven Spielberg directed motion capture blockbuster will no doubt bring the adventures of Tintin to a whole new generation of fans – but what about the gamers out there?

Ubisoft have just released The Adventure of Tintin: Secret of the Unicorn – The Game. As with most movie tie ins, it’s available on almost every current gen console, and is appearing on the Wii, PS3, Xbox 360 and Nintendo 3DS. Developed in close collaboration with the film makers, the game follows key moments of the movie (so spoilers for those who want to see the film come December), and has a big emphasis on co-operative gameplay.

 

Players will be able to play as Tintin himself, the ever amusingly named Captain Haddock, the Thompson Twins and more (including Snowy of course). The PS3 and Xbox 360 versions are Move and Kinect compatible respectively, so gamers with the latest kit can test out the Secret of the Unicorn with an added level of interaction. New BioWare Video Shows Off Mass Effect 3 Combat

In a new episode of BioWare Pulse, the devs from BioWare Edmonton show off some of the new combat mechanics and abilities available to players in Mass Effect 3.

These include the Vanguard’s new ability to sacrifice his shields in order to send a shockwave bursting out from beneath him, the Engineer’s turret ability, an upgrade to Mass Effect 2’s Overload so that it chains across enemies, and the new heavy melee attacks. The video also demonstrates some of the new tactical approaches available to certain classes in unique combat situations. Biotics can pull the blast shields off of Guardians, and players with the Hack ability can turn turrets set up by the enemy Engineers against their creators.
